Countless generations of the Gleize family have looked after this 18th century post house. The balconies, the mosaiced walkways and the almond-green shutters are the work of Jany, the latest in the line. In the kitchen he reinvents the Provencal recipes of grandmother Gabrielle, with traditional flavours. Sweets are a tribute to Jany’s father, Pierre, a confectioner. Sample the delicious lavender honey ice cream served in it’s bee hive. A vegetable and a landscaped garden blend flowers, fruit and vegetables. La Bonne Étape Restaurant

Chef Jany Gleize

1 Michelin Star 2026


Expression of the terroir

Telling the story of his native land, and sharing it through reworked Provençal recipes: this is the culinary methodology of chef Jany Gleize at gastronomic restaurant La Bonne Etape. In its warm atmosphere, it combines family spirit with gastronomy, conviviality with authenticity.

Visiting the cellar

This unique experience is offered to you by our head sommelier. Whether you just like fine wines or are a fervent connoisseur of superior vintages, he'll invite you to follow him into our cellar, which you'll discover through a secret passageway leading to the underground tunnels beneath the house dating back to just after the French revolution. Fabulous aging cellars await you with nearly 3,000 bottles of more than 750 wines. Enthralled, you'll go from exquisite surprises to exciting discoveries. An exceptional moment, simply unforgettable

The Moulin Fortuné Arizzi, producer of olive oil

For more than twenty years, La Bonne étape has maintained a special relationship with the Moulin Fortuné Arizzi, a producer of extra pure virgin olive oil from Haute-Provence, located 10 miles from the property in the Durance Valley. We invite you to visit this exceptional estate to discover the production secrets of this region's oil, created from a medley of three olive varieties: aglandau, picholine and frantoio. At the start of the visit, a tasting introduction will allow you to explore all the sensory qualities of this treasure from Provençal cuisine.
